Cheekbone fractures

The face is susceptible to injury, one of the most common injuries to the cheekbone is a fracture or break. Damage to the cheekbone can be very painful and have a lasting effect on an individual.

The cheekbone can also be referred to as the zygomatic bone or malar bone. Cheekbone injuries are commonly caused as a result of traffic accidents, assaults, slips, trips and falls, and sporting injuries, and can result in:

  • Bruising
  • Fractures/ Breaks
  • Loss of sensation
  • Misshapen cheek
  • Swelling

What are the common causes of cheekbone fractures?

  • Sporting injuries – e.g. Boxing, Football
  • Road traffic accident.
  • Pedestrian accident.
  • Accident at work.
  • Slip trip and fall.
  • Assault.
  • Clinical negligence.

    How will the compensation be calculated?

    The key factor of consideration for compensation is the severity of the injury which you have sustained, the type of accident does not determine the compensation amounts. After a report has been put together by a specialist or expert, which is based upon GP notes and medical examinations, the level of compensation can be determined.

    The report includes details regarding the injury, its severity and the subsequent consequences of the injury due to the accident. After this report has been provided to the solicitors, using case law and analysis an idea of what you could expect to receive will be provided.

    There are two types of compensation awarded, general damages which compensates for the victims pain and suffering of the injury and special damages which includes financial losses and expenses.

    How much could you claim?

    Injuries to the cheekbone vary in severity, ranging from surgery to permanent damage, and the amount of compensation awarded will reflect this. A claim can be made to help cover any loss of earnings, medical costs and psychological impact.

    Minor injuries:

    up to £1,500

    More serious injuries:

    up to £5,500

    Broken nose recovering naturally:

    approximately £1,500

    *The amounts indicated are intended as a guide only, your personal circumstances will influence the total amount if you have a claim.
